Transaction 44e2cc944159f7a49de951603ed61aa2587e86b3bb81e289a445e9b68d0f7c03

1 Input
2 Outputs
  • 44e2cc944159f7a49de951603ed61aa2587e86b3bb81e289a445e9b68d0f7c03:0
  • value  340511415
    address  174h2sMAA4r6neNVfrrWZhMy7JW8bsd2gA
  • 44e2cc944159f7a49de951603ed61aa2587e86b3bb81e289a445e9b68d0f7c03:1
  • value  3013567
    address  1B63D2E7bQBSMePQ5xAruVMok66kJD8ZKm